#100d58 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#100d58 is composed of 6.3% red, 5.1%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81.8% cyan, 85.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 65.5% black. It has a hue angle of 242.4 degrees, a saturation of 74.3% and a lightness of 19.8%. #100d58 color hex could be obtained by blending #201ab0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000066.

● #100d58 color description : Very dark blue.
The hexadecimal color #100d58 has RGB values of R:16, G:13, B:88 and CMYK values of C:0.82, M:0.85, Y:0, K:0.65. Its decimal value is 1051992.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000003 is the darkest color, while #f1f0fd is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#303035 is the less saturated color, while #050164 is the most saturated one.
